Business Wireless Backhaul Network

What is a wireless backhaul? In telecommunications, a wireless backhaul is a communications solution that transmits data from one network end point to another. This service is also known as wireless network point to point or wireless point to multipoint. Wireless backhaul refers to the process of transferring the data back to the network backbone. Business wireless networks are used to connect multisite businesses, academic institutions or government agencies when traditional wireline services maybe unavailable or cost prohibitive. A wireless point to point network can be used to connect two or more location in urban or rural areas. Business wireless networks can reach up to 100 miles and provide a wide range of high speed bandwidth options. Business wireless service can also be used to back up traditional wireline service such as Ethernet.

Virtual Private Networks VPNs

What is a Virtual Private Network? In telecommunications, Virtual Private Networks VPNs provide a secure, reliable and cost-effective solution for communications across a centralized network. Virtual Private Networks VPNs are used to connect multiple remote sites and users to a network anywhere where there is Internet access. Virtual Private Networks are encrypted and authenticated through networking equipment and hardware at each remote site. Virtual Private Network solutions are typically more cost-effective than private leased lines and offer greater flexibility. Virtual Private Networks VPNs data connections can be comprised of DSL, T1, T3, OCn and Ethernet.

There are several different types of Virtual Private Networks including MPLS based IP VPN, IPsec VPN and SSL IP VPN solutions. MPLS based IP VPN or MPLS IP-VPN is a Virtual Private Network over Multiprotocol Label Switching (MPLS) technology. MPLS IP VPN is scalable, secure and supports Quality of Service (QoS) for traffic engineering. IPsec VPN provides a Layer 3 VPN connection and is highly cost effective. SSL IP-VPN is used in remote access rather than site-to-site VPNs. SSL IP VPN supports only SSL applications which includes email and other applications.

Metropolitan Area Networks MAN

What is a Metropolitan Area Network? In telecommunications, a Metropolitan Area Network MAN is a networking solution used to connect multiple remote sites and users within a geographical area or specific region. Metropolitan Area Networks are larger than Local Area Networks (LANs) but smaller than Wide Area Networks (WANs). Metro Area Networks MANs occur within a specific city or metropolitan area and interconnect several Local Area Networks through a backbone also referred to as a campus network. A Metro Area Network MAN provides a secure, reliable and cost effective solution for businesses that communicate across a centralized network.

OC 768 Internet Connection

What is an OC 768? In telecommunications, an OC768 is the abbreviated version of Optical Carrier Level 768 which indicates the bandwidth speed of the internet connection according to Synchronous Optical Network (SONET) standards. SONET is a set of signal rate multiples utilized in the transmission of digital signals through fiber optics. An OC 768 connection provides bandwidth up to 40 Gbps and is the equivalent of four OC 192 connections. OC768 is primarily used by government, large enterprises and carriers as an ISP backbone.

OC192 Internet Connection Bandwidth

What is an OC192 Connection? In telecommunications, OC192 stands for Optical Carrier Level 192 which indicates the bandwidth speed of the connection according to Synchronous Optical Network (SONET) standards. SONET is a set of signal rate multiples used in transmitting digital signals through fiber optic cable. What is the speed of an OC192 bandwidth? OC192 Internet provides speeds of up to 9953.28 Mbps or approximately 9.6 Gbps. An OC192 connection is the equivalent of four OC48 connection. OC192 Internet connections are primarily used by large enterprises, government agencies or as an ISP backbone.

Cloud Computing Services

What is cloud computing service? In telecommunications, cloud computing refers to Internet based computing also known as virtualization, whereby shared resources, software and information are provided to computers and devices on-demand in the cloud. The cloud is a reference to the Internet. Business cloud computing services directly contrast with traditional computing as there is no need to install applications or save files to a personal computer. A common example of cloud computing service is Yahoo email or Gmail. Users do not need software or a server to use the email service.

There are several segments associated with business cloud computing services which include the following: (1) applications, (2) platforms and (3) infrastructure. The applications refer to the on-demand software also referred to as Software as a Service (SaaS). There are several forms of payments including subscription fees and licensing. Within cloud computing services, platforms are product offerings used to deploy to the Internet. Active platforms allow the end user to access applications from centralized servers using the Internet. For example, Microsoft's cloud computing platform is Windows Live and Rackspace has cloudservers, cloudsites and cloudfiles. Infrastructure plays a vital role in cloud computing services and is the backbone of the entire concept. Within cloud computing, infrastructure provides the environment necessary to allow users to build applications. Infrastructure also includes storage services for cloud computing.

Gig Ethernet, Gigabit Ethernet Network Service

What is Gigabit Ethernet? In telecommunications, Gigabit Ethernet (GigE Ethernet, Gig Ethernet) supports data transfer rates of 1 Gigabit (1,000 Megabits) per second as defined by the IEEE 802.3-2008 standard. Gigabit Ethernet services are an extension of popular Fast Ethernet which includes speeds of 10 and 100 Mbps. In addition to 1 Gigabit Ethernet, there is 10 Gigabit Ethernet and 40 Gigabit Ethernet available in select locations. Gigabit Ethernet service is designed for global reach and metro depth and can be utilized through public, private, switched, metro, long haul, point-to-point and point-to-multipoint access. 

The benefits associated with Gigabit Ethernet service including the following: cost-effectiveness, high speed access and scalability. Gigabit Ethernet is one of the most cost-effective service based on a price per megabit. GigE service also provides increased reliability with most providers offering Service Level Agreements (SLAs) which guarantee 99.99% uptime and 24x7 customer support. GigE Ethernet service also provides Class of Service (CoS) which allows for the prioritization of applications. Gig Ethernet also simplifies LAN/WAN interconnectivity allowing for lower capital and operating costs. Gigabit Ethernet service is ideal for businesses with bandwidth intensive applications requiring additional bandwidth to avoid network bottlenecks and congestion.

MPLS IP VPN

What is MPLS IP-VPN? In telecommunications, Multi Protocol Label Switching (MPLS) Internet Protocol Virtual Private Network (IP-VPN) is a business networking technology used to transfer data between sites or within a Wide Area Network (WAN). MPLS IP-VPN is based on MPLS which utilizes labeling algorithms and signaling protocols to encapsulate IP packets and distribute VPN information efficiently throughout the network. With an MPLS based IP-VPN, forwarding decisions are based on the label without the need to examine the packet. At the destination, the edge router or device removes the label to present the data in its original form. MPLS IP-VPN can be used for numerous applications including business VoIP, content delivery, email, file transfers/ sharing, data storage and backup as well as remote user access.

There are many benefits associated with MPLS IP-VPN including the following: more bandwidth at a lower cost, faster deployment, lower operating costs and scalability. MPLS IP-VPN supports a wide range of protocols and bandwidth service options including T1 / DS1, T3 / DS3, (Optical Carrier) OCn and Ethernet. MPLS IP-VPN also provides options for Class of Service (CoS) allowing for application prioritization and Service Level Agreements (SLAs) which guarantee against packet loss and jitter.

Integrated T1 Line Service

Are you searching for a reliable and cost-effective solution for both voice and data communications? If so, an integrated T1 line may be the right solution for all of your business communications needs. An integrated T1, also called a channelized T1, provides 24 channels with a maximum speed of 1.54 Mbps or 64 Kbps. In comparison to DSL, a T1 line carries approximately 192,000 bytes per second which is roughly 60 times a DSL modem. Integrated T1 service can several applications such as local phone service, long distance, Internet, and business voice over IP (VoIP).

There are two configurations for an integrated T1 including static and dynamic configurations. Most T1 providers offer dynamic T1 lines. With a dynamic integrated T1 line, once a channel is free from use it can be used for either voice or data. This allows for greater flexibility to handle all of the voice and data needs of your business as needed. With a static T1, the provider provisions a certain amount of channels for either voice or data.

There are many advantages associated with integrated T1 service including cost-savings, reliability and flexibility. Voice T1 Line Service Provider Pricing

What is a voice T1 line? A business voice t1 line is a fiber optic line and sometimes a copper line that is capable of carrying 24 digitized voice channels. With T1 phone service, there are 23 channels available for voice and a single channel dedicated for data transmissions such as caller ID. Business voice T1 lines connect directly into your office's phone system. A single voice T1 line can handle the calling needs of an office with 23 simultaneous phone calls. Another option, bonded voice T1 line, allows you to increase the number of channels from 23 voice channels to 46.

There are many advantages associated with a voice T1 line including the increased potential for cost-savings, reliability and service flexibility. Dense Wavelength Division Multiplexing DWDM

What is DWDM? In telecommunications, Dense Wavelength Division Multiplexing (DWDM) is a network transport technology that allows data from different sources to combine together over an optical fiber with each signal being carried at the same time on its own light wavelength. Dense Wavelength Division Multiplexing is also commonly referred to as DWDM, Optical Wavelength, Wave Division Multiplexing (WDM), Network Multiplexing and Optical Transport Network. Dense Wavelength Division Multiplexing (DWDM) allows businesses to interconnect multiple locations with high capacity bandwidth.

With Dense Wavelength Division Multiplexing (DWDM), up to 80 separate wavelengths of data can be multiplexed into a light-stream transmission on a single optical fiber. In a DWDM network with each channel carrying 2.5 Gbps, up to 200 billion bits per second can be delivered over DWDM fiber. With Dense Wavelength Division Multiplexing (DWDM) allows different data formats to be transferred at different rates together. Internet Protocol (IP) data, SONET and Asynchronous Transfer Mode (ATM) data all at the same time over DWDM optical fiber.

Content Distribution Networks

What are Content Distribution Networks? In telecommunications, Content Distribution Networks allow your online content, media, software, applications and documents to be stored at server Points of Presence (PoPs) for access by your end users. Content Distribution Networks are also commonly referred to as Content Delivery Networks, CDN and Content Distribution. The primary purpose of Content Distribution Networks are to improve (1) network performance, (2) scalability/ reach and (3) end user experience. The end user can be a visitor to your website, customer, partner or employee. With a Content Distribution Network, content is a reference for web objects, online and downloadable media, software and applications, shared documents, real time streaming, HD and more.

What are the benefits of a Content Distribution Network? There are many advantages to Content Distribution Networks including the ability to maximize bandwidth utilization. This occurs by providing content to end users through multiple targeted geographical locations instead of end users accessing only your centralized server. Content Distribution Services result in greater network performance by reducing bottlenecks and network congestion due to a lack of bandwidth availability. Content Distribution Networks are ideal for http, interactive web media, mobile media, online advertising, streaming media and applications.

Virtual Private LAN Service VPLS

What is VPLS?  In telecommunications, Virtual Private LAN Service (VPLS) is a Layer 2 Ethernet Virtual Private Network (VPN) enabling the connection of multiple Ethernet sites over MPLS private or metro networks. With Virtual Private LAN Service VPLS, all sites appear to be on the same LAN regardless of their geographical location. Furthermore, each site has its own Ethernet VPLS that is completed segregated from other customers across the share carrier network. Virtual Private LAN Service VPLS was created to overcome the limitations and challenges posed by ATM and Frame Relay which included providing protocol transparent, any-to-any, fully meshed network across a Wide Area Network (WAN).

Virtual Private LAN Service VPLS is based on native Ethernet which simplifies the LAN/WAN boundary for both carriers and customers. Therefore, Virtual Private LAN Service allows for rapid provisioning with the flexibility to add or change bandwidth at any time because the service bandwidth is not tied to the physical interface. Virtual Private LAN Service VPLS supports a wide range of bandwidth speeds ranging from 1 Mbps to 1 Gbps in increments of 1 Mbps.

There are several benefits associated with Virtual Private LAN Service VPLS. Virtual Private LAN Service VPLS is transparent, protocol independent and offers a multipoint solution with a shared bandwidth pool for remote sites. With Virtual Private LAN Service, you are in complete control of switching and routing between sites. However, Virtual Private LAN Service VPLS offer a more simplistic approach to Wide Area Networking and therefore offers ease of management. Furthermore, Virtual Private LAN Service is cost-effective and offers scalability not found in other networking technologies.

Point to Point Network Service

What is point to point? In telecommunications, point to point service is a dedicated circuit or private switching arrangement with predefined transmission paths. Point to point networks, also referred to as PPT networks, are used by businesses to connect two or more locations. Point to point service offers greater reliability, security and flexibility when it comes to your business communications. With a point to point network, your business will experience lower latency and network congestion as a result of the service using a dedicated private circuit rather than a public or shared network.

As briefly mentioned above, point to point service offers greater flexibility and a point to point can be provisioned to carry various transport services. With point to point service, your business can choose from a point to point T1, point to point T3, Ethernet point to point or OCn point to point connections. With point to point, your business will be able to reduce costs by consolidating voice, data and video over a single connection. Point to point pricing is dependent on several factors including geographic location of connecting sites, point to point provider and point to point service options.
